Is there a limit to the number of process flows an EG project can have?

Matthew,

No, no hard limit. Of course, the more flows you have and the larger your project, the more difficult you might find it to manage.

Actually, I am using the multiple flows in order to manage the project more effectively. Each flow has a single function like creating a single calculated field. This allows for more modular development so that each module (i.e. flow) is simple and maintainable but the project as a whole is complex...see what I mean?
